A customer pointed out that there's a slight difference between the beginning and end of each line. In other works the beginning and end of the line are darker than the rest. It's not a LOT different but they have a great deal of detail and I understand their concern. I'mg guessing the machine takes a brief time to accelerate from zero at the beginning and back again at the end? I have a request in to tech support but wonder if anyone has any suggestions? My Trotec has a setting specifically for that issue, yours may as well. If not, you could draw something outside of the limits of the graphic you are lasering and force the laser on earlier/off later that way. I can do that with a non-lasering color, you might be able to as well.

You have a Chinese Rabbit, does it have 2 power settings in Vector mode, the second setting may be called something like 'corner power'? If so, lower the lower power setting, it's there to compensate for when the machine slows down from full speed to make a corner or to stop, and for when it starts moving until it reaches full speed, then the higher setting kicks in. If your software allows for 'circle speed limits', the lower power setting is used when the speed limit kicks in..

If you are using rdworks it is the min/max setting
Set the max to the % you need to cut the line at and the min to the minimum power setting that still allows the laser tube to fire (approx. 10% of tube rating)
This lets the controller reduce the tube power setting when the head slows down and when it speeds up

Having min=max means the tube firing longer over target when it is stopped at the end of a line than when it is moving at the set speed

You can also look at overrun settings
This lets the head run past the end of the line and thus during the accel/decel portions of the head movement the controller can shut off the laser completely
